What is APhA?American Pharmacists AssociationLargest professional pharmacy organization
Through information, education, and advocacyAPhA empowers its members to improvemedication use and advance patient care
Only non-govt building on the national mall

Katys KidsKaty's Kids exposeskindergarten throughsecond grade children tothe benefits of medications
safetyMedication is not candy
This interactive programuses a student pharmacistdressed as a kangaroo kids
named Katy to teachstudents the role of doctorsand pharmacists in safemedication usage and todrive home the message
that not all drugs are bad.Kat visits several local
